XRP Faces Mounting Selling Pressure as Exchange Inflows Surge Amid 50% Price Correction

XRP continues to struggle under intense selling pressure as the digital asset trades near $1.90, representing a dramatic 50% decline from its recent peak of $3.66. The sharp correction has been accompanied by a significant surge in exchange inflows, particularly to major trading platforms like Binance, signaling that the market has yet to find a stable accumulation phase.

Exchange Inflows Paint a Concerning Picture

According to blockchain analytics from CryptoQuant, the current market dynamics reveal a clear intensification of selling pressure across XRP markets. The most telling indicator comes from exchange inflow data, which shows a marked shift in investor behavior starting around December 15.

Prior to mid-December, XRP inflows to exchanges maintained relatively moderate and stable levels. However, the situation changed dramatically as daily inflow volumes began ranging from 35 million XRP to a significant peak of 116 million XRP recorded on December 19. These elevated inflows, particularly concentrated on Binance which handles the largest trading volumes among all exchanges, typically indicate positioning for potential sales.

From HODLing to Profit-Taking

The persistent nature of these elevated inflows suggests more than just temporary market volatility. Market analysis indicates a fundamental shift in investor behavior, moving away from the holding strategy that dominated since October toward active profit-taking among longer-term positions and capitulation selling from more recent market entrants.

This behavioral transition is particularly significant because it represents ongoing distribution rather than the type of clean washout that might signal a market bottom. As long as these elevated inflows persist or intensify further, establishing a true accumulation phase becomes increasingly difficult for XRP.

Broader Market Liquidity Constraints

The challenges facing XRP extend beyond individual token dynamics, reflecting broader liquidity constraints across the entire cryptocurrency market. Stablecoin market capitalization has been stagnating over recent weeks, indicating a lack of fresh fiat-to-crypto conversion that typically drives bull market momentum.

Exchange inflow data reveals the scale of this liquidity squeeze. Monthly average inflows to exchanges have been cut in half since September, dropping from $136 billion to approximately $70 billion. The annual average has also begun declining over the past few weeks, suggesting that available liquidity remains largely sidelined despite not leaving the market entirely.

Market Sentiment Shifts Bearish

Sentiment indicators across multiple data sources, including social media analysis and news coverage, show that market consensus has turned decidedly bearish. This shift in collective sentiment often precedes market reversals, as contrarian indicators suggest that when shared consensus forms, markets tend to prove the majority wrong.

Historical patterns from similar setups between July-October 2024 and February-April 2025 show that bearish sentiment phases can persist for extended periods, particularly when markets enter prolonged correction cycles. The current bearish phase, which began in early November, may still have room to develop before any meaningful reversal occurs.

Technical Outlook Remains Challenging

From a technical perspective, XRP’s journey from $3.66 to current levels around $1.85-$1.90 represents one of the more severe corrections among major cryptocurrencies this cycle. The combination of persistent selling pressure, elevated exchange inflows, and broader market liquidity constraints suggests that any recovery may face significant headwinds.

The key metric to watch remains exchange inflows, particularly to Binance and other major trading venues. A sustained reduction in these inflows would be necessary to signal that selling pressure is beginning to subside and that accumulation patterns might emerge.

Until market conditions shift substantially, with either fresh liquidity entering the space or a meaningful reduction in distribution activity, XRP faces the prospect of an extended correction period that could deepen beyond current levels.
